ENDEAVOUR at the Tees Barrage 06.04.18, ready for lifting out of the water and over the small lock and placing her downstream of the Barrage for towing up to the dry dock for repairs.

ENDEAVOUR outwards from the Tees bound for Whitby under tow of the DSV CURTIS MARSHALL 01.06.18
